Rob Roth, founder of the cyber-fetish party Click + Drag, shot photos of dozens of rock stars, dominatrixes, transsexuals, strippers and fetishists for his promotional flyers between 1999 and 2001. Despite his affinity for the digital world, Roth used only 35mm film and never retouched the images. All of these will be on display, along with three digital works Roth later created for the reboot of Click + Drag as an annual event; for this year's installment, see Sat 9.
